E621 first referred to monosodium glutamate, or MSG, years before it meant related to furries. MSG is a flavor enhancer found in many foods. E621 is what's known as the E number (a standardized code for substances in Europe) for MSG. The website e621.net launched in February 2007.

E621, also known as monosodium glutamate (MSG), is a flavor enhancer commonly found in processed and packaged foods. While it is regarded as safe by many regulatory agencies, some people may experience side effects after consuming foods that contain MSG. Monosodium glutamate ( MSG ), also known as sodium glutamate, is a sodium salt of glutamic acid. MSG is found naturally in some foods including tomatoes and cheese in this glutamic acid form.
